Jak vytvořit databázi v mysql
MySQL může být děsivý program. Všechny příkazy musí být zadány přes příkazový řádek - neexistuje žádné pohodlné rozhraní. Proto věděl, jak vytvořit databázi a manipulovat to může ušetřit spoustu času a nervu. Postupujte podle pokynů k vytvoření databáze amerických států a jejich obyvatelstva.
Kroky
Metoda 1 z 2:
Vytváření a manipulace s databázíjeden. Vytvořit databázi. V příkazovém řádku MySQL zadejte příkaz
Vytvořit databázi -
. Nahradit
Název své databáze. Nemůže obsahovat mezery.- Chcete-li například vytvořit databázi všech amerických států, můžete zadat
Vytvořit databázi us_states-
- Poznámka: Příkazy nejsou nutně podávány v velkým písmenům.
- Poznámka: Všechny příkazy MySQL musí skončit ";". Pokud zapomenete dát bod s čárkou, pak jednoduše zadejte ";" na další řádek spustit zpracování předchozího příkazu.

2. Zobrazit seznam dostupných databází. Zadejte příkaz
Zobrazit databáze-
, Zobrazení seznamu uložených databází. Kromě databáze právě vytvořené, zobrazí také databáze mysql
a Test
. Nyní je můžete ignorovat.
3. Vyberte databázi. Když je databáze vytvořena, musíte jej vybrat, abyste mohli začít editovat. Zadejte příkaz
Použijte us_states-
. Uvidíte zprávu Databáze se změnila
, což oznámí, že nyní aktivní databáze je us_states
.
4. Vytvořit tabulku. Tabulka je umístění úložiště v databázi. Chcete-li vytvořit tabulku, musíte zadat celou strukturu s jedním příkazem. Chcete-li vytvořit tabulku, zadejte takový příkaz:
Vytvořit stavy tabulky (ID int Not null Primární klíč Auto__increment, State Char (25), Populace Int (9))-
. Tento příkaz vytvoří tabulku s názvem "Stavy" se třemi poli: ID
, Stát
, A populace
.Int
Označuje, že pole ID
Bude obsahovat pouze čísla (celá čísla).NENULOVÝ
Označuje, že pole ID
by neměl být prázdný (nutně pro vstup).PRIMÁRNÍ KLÍČ
označuje pole ID
je kuželové pole v tabulce. Pole klíče je pole, které nemohou obsahovat stejné hodnoty.Auto_increment
automaticky přiřadí rostoucí hodnoty ID
, v podstatě automaticky očíslovat každý záznam.Char
(symboly) a Int
(celá čísla) označují typ dat povolený v odpovídajících polích. Číslo vedle příkazu označuje, kolik znaků nebo čísel může pole obsahovat.
Pět. Vytvořte vstup do tabulky. Nyní, když je tabulka vytvořena, je čas zadat informace. Chcete-li zadat první záznam, použijte následující příkaz:
Vložka do států (ID, stát, populace) hodnot (null, `Alabama`, `4822023`)-
ID
Obsahuje identifikátor NENULOVÝ
, Tento vstup NULA
Jako hodnota to nutí, aby se díky identifikátoru zvýšil Auto_increment
.
6. Vytvořit více záznamů. Můžete uložit mnoho položek pomocí stejného příkazu. Chcete-li uložit další tři stavy, zadejte takový příkaz:
Vložka do států (ID, stát, populace) hodnoty (null, "Aljaška", "731449"), (null, "Arizona", "6553255"), (null, "Arkansas", "2949131") t-
.

7. Proveďte požadavek na databázi. Nyní, když je vytvořena jednoduchá databáze, můžete provést požadavky k odstranění požadovaných informací. Začněte, zadejte následující příkaz:
Vyberte * od us_states-
. Tento dotaz vrátí celou databázi, která je zobrazena příkazem "*", což znamená "vše".Vyberte stav, obyvatelstvo z US_States Objednat obyvatelstvo-
Tento požadavek vrátí tabulku se stavy seřazené podle počtu obyvatelstva, namísto třídění podle názvu v abecedním pořadí. Pole ID
nebude zobrazen, protože jste položili pouze pole Stát
a populace
.Vyberte stav, obyvatelstvo z US_States objednávky podle obyvatelstva-
. tým Desc
Zobrazit státy sestupují počet obyvatel (od více na méně, a ne z menších až po více).Metoda 2 z 2:
Pokračování s MySQLjeden. Nainstalujte databázový server MySQL v počítači. Zjistěte, jak nainstalovat MySQL na domácím počítači.

2. Smazat databázi MySQL. Zjistěte, jak odstranit databázi, pokud potřebujete odstranit staré a zbytečné informace.

3. Prozkoumejte MySQL a PHP. PHP a MySQL znalosti vám umožní vytvářet výkonné webové stránky pro zábavu a práci.

4. Vytvořit zálohu dat v MySQL. Vždy se doporučuje vytvořit zálohování dat, zejména pokud je databáze velmi důležitá.

Pět. Proveďte změny struktury databáze v MySQL. Pokud se mění požadavky databáze, můžete vždy upravit strukturu tak, aby ukládala další informace.
Tipy
- Níže jsou uvedeny jedním z nejčastěji používaných datových typů: (Plný seznam lze zobrazit v dokumentaci MySQL http: // dev.mysql.Com / doc /)
- Char(délka) - Řetězec s pevným počtem znaků "Délka".
- Varchar(délka) - Řetězec s jiným počtem znaků, ale maximální počet znaků je "Délka".
- TEXT - řetězec s různými znaky, ale maximální počet znaků je 64kb text.
- Int(délka) - 32-bitové číslo s maximálním počtem čísel délka (";" To je považováno za "číslici" pro záporné číslo.)
- Desetinný(délka,Des) - desetinné číslo s maximální "délkou" zobrazených čísel. Pole Des Označuje maximální počet výbojů v desetinné části.
- Datum - Datum (rok, měsíc, den))
- Čas - Čas (hodiny, minuty, sekundy)
- Enum("Význam1"" ""Význam2", ....) - Seznam uvedených hodnot.